2012 C300W4 pulling towards right
Hi,
I am newbie to this forum...
I recently (actually in May) bought 2012 C300W4 sports sedan.
It has 4000+ miles on it and I noticed that when I take my had off the steering wheel, it tends to pull towards right on a straight pavement.
I have already been to dealer twice and they kept the vehicle for day did some alignment, camber and castor settings to the spec and it still has the same problem.
I would like to know if anyone else has the same issues. My 11 year old Lexus was tracking pretty straight but not sure about these new cars.
I would also like to know what options I have if dealer is not able to fix this if it is a genuine issue with the car.

Fit fluted bolts & dial in one more degree castor (max 2) on the passenger side than drivers side & the pull will be gone. Typically 9.6 degrees & 10.6 degrees. Method is in the Wiki.
Pull with road camber is common & easily fixed.
